Welcome to Lombok, the stunning Indonesian island that offers a more serene but equally captivating alternative to its famous neighbor, Bali. As a port of call for cruise lines like Seabourn and Holland America Line, Lombok enchants visitors with its pristine white-sand beaches, lush volcanic landscapes, and rich cultural heritage.
Cruise passengers are drawn to its authentic charm, from the traditional Sasak villages to the majestic presence of an active volcano. It's the perfect destination for travelers seeking both relaxation on secluded shores and adventure in the great outdoors.
One of the most popular excursions is a trip to the southern coast to visit the famous Kuta Beach (not to be confused with Bali's) and the stunning Tanjung Aan Beach, known for their brilliant white sand and turquoise waters. This area is about a 1.5-hour drive from the port.
A visit to a traditional Sasak village, such as Sade or Ende, offers a fascinating glimpse into the lives of Lombok's indigenous people. Here you can see unique thatched-roof houses and learn about local customs and weaving traditions.
For nature lovers, the foothills of the mighty Mt. Rinjani (Gunung Rinjani) offer breathtaking scenery. A day trip might include a visit to the spectacular Sendang Gile and Tiu Kelep waterfalls, though this requires a longer drive of about 2.5-3 hours each way from Lembar Harbour.
Closer to the port, the resort town of Senggigi provides beautiful beaches, art markets, and seaside restaurants, reachable within an hour's drive.

The Gili Islands are a trio of tiny, idyllic islands located off the northwest coast of Lombok. Gili Trawangan, Gili Meno, and Gili Air are famous for their coral reefs, sea turtles, and car-free atmosphere, making them perfect for a snorkeling or diving adventure. Reaching them requires a 1.5 to 2-hour drive from Lembar to a departure point, followed by a short boat trip.
Mataram, the capital city of the province, is just a 30-45 minute drive from the port. It offers a more urban experience with sights like the Mayura Water Palace and the Narmada Park, giving visitors a look into the island's royal history and local life.

Cruise ships dock at Lembar Harbour, located on the southwestern coast of Lombok. This is an industrial and ferry port, so there are very few tourist amenities within walking distance.
The port is approximately 22 kilometers (14 miles) from the island's capital, Mataram, which is about a 30-45 minute drive away. The main tourist area of Senggigi is about an hour's drive north. Due to the distances, transportation such as a taxi or a pre-arranged shore excursion is necessary to explore the island's attractions.

The official currency is the Indonesian Rupiah (IDR). While US dollars may be accepted by some tour operators, it is highly recommended to use the local currency for all other purchases, especially in markets and smaller establishments.
ATMs are available in the main towns like Mataram and Senggigi, and currency exchange services can also be found there. Credit cards are accepted at major hotels, resorts, and larger restaurants, but cash is essential for shopping at local markets, for transportation, and in rural areas.

Lombok is generally a safe destination for tourists, but it is wise to take standard precautions. Be mindful of your belongings in crowded areas to avoid petty theft. Only use licensed taxis or reputable transport providers arranged through your cruise line or a trusted agent.
When swimming or snorkeling, be aware of ocean currents, which can be strong in some areas. It is generally safe to explore independently in the main tourist centers like Senggigi, but for visiting more remote attractions, a guided tour is recommended to navigate the island efficiently and overcome any language barriers.

Lombok has a tropical climate, meaning it is warm and humid throughout the year. The cruise season typically coincides with the dry season, which runs from May to September. During this time, you can expect plenty of sunshine and average temperatures ranging from 25°C to 32°C (77°F to 90°F).
The wet season occurs from October to April, characterized by heavier rainfall and higher humidity, though the rain often comes in short, intense bursts. Regardless of the season, it is best to pack lightweight clothing, sunscreen, a hat, and insect repellent. A light raincoat is also a good idea, particularly during the wet season.

Transportation from Lembar Harbour is essential to see the sights. The most convenient option for cruise passengers is to book a shore excursion or hire a private car with a driver for the day, which can often be arranged at the port.
Taxis are available, with Blue Bird being the most reputable metered taxi company. It is advisable to agree on a fare before starting your journey if the taxi is unmetered. While ride-sharing apps like Grab and Gojek operate on the island, their availability at the port can be limited. Public transport, known as bemo (minivans), is not recommended for tourists on a tight schedule.

Lombok is renowned for its traditional handicrafts, making it a great place for souvenir shopping. The Sukarara village is famous for its intricate hand-woven textiles, including songket and ikat fabrics, where you can watch the weavers at work.
For pottery, the village of Banyumulek is a must-visit. The Senggigi Art Market offers a wide variety of souvenirs, from wooden carvings and masks to clothing and jewelry. Remember that bargaining is a common and expected practice in markets and with local vendors. Lombok is also known for its pearl farming, and authentic South Sea pearls can be a unique purchase.
